+2 I've recently got back into Condor again after a few years away from gaming in general. I purchased the new clouds yesterday. I did a quick ridge task for testing. They look great, very realistic IMO. I didn't notice any real drop in frame rates either. Or if there are it's very slight 1-3. Even with my aging 2 Ghz P4 & NV 6800 512mb card I still average around 55-65fps. Keep up the great work Alan :)

Love2Fly wrote:
Does these new clouds eats more or less FPS, in comparison with the original ones??


Frank,

From my hour long test flight. I found the FPS the same or at times a very minor loss likely -1 to -3 max drop. Although I wasn't constantly monitoring fps. Overall I saw nothing that affected the flight experience. It runs/felt the same as with the default clouds. As Benny mentioned for the quality, no one could likely tell missing 1-3 frames at times.
